Financial Performance - Revenues for Q1 2025 were $15.2 million, a decrease of 34.6% compared to $23.2 million in Q1 2024[5] - Net loss for Q1 2025 was $4.9 million, compared to a net loss of $4.2 million in Q1 2024[5] - Adjusted EBITDA loss was $1.2 million in Q1 2025, down from a positive Adjusted EBITDA of $0.2 million in Q1 2024[5] - For the three months ended March 31, 2025, the company reported a net loss of $4,890,000, compared to a net loss of $4,241,000 for the same period in 2024, reflecting an increase in loss of approximately 15.4%[23] - Revenues for the same period were $15,165,000, down 34.7% from $23,219,000 in the prior year[23] - The adjusted EBITDA loss for the three months ended March 31, 2025, was $1,235,000, compared to an adjusted EBITDA of $168,000 for the same period in 2024, indicating a significant decline[23] - The adjusted EBITDA loss margin was reported at (8.1)% for Q1 2025, compared to a positive margin of 0.7% in Q1 2024[23] - The net loss margin for Q1 2025 was (32.2)%, compared to (18.3)% in Q1 2024, indicating a worsening of profitability[25] Future Projections - The company expects full-year 2025 revenues to be in the range of $84 million to $88 million[6] - The company anticipates Adjusted EBITDA for the full year 2025 to be between $2.0 million and $4.0 million[6] Cash and Assets Management - Cash and cash equivalents increased to $6.1 million as of March 31, 2025, from $5.6 million at the end of 2024[17] - Total assets decreased to $28.8 million as of March 31, 2025, from $29.4 million at the end of 2024[17] - Total liabilities increased to $32.3 million as of March 31, 2025, compared to $29.9 million at the end of 2024[17] - Cash and cash equivalents at the end of the period were $6,123,000, down from $12,603,000 at the end of Q1 2024, indicating a decrease of approximately 51.5%[23] - The company reported a net cash used in financing activities of $518,000 for Q1 2025, a significant decrease from $5,583,000 in Q1 2024, reflecting improved cash management[23] Operational Metrics - The company had 472 platform participants as of March 31, 2025, a decrease from 671 participants in the same period last year, representing a decline of approximately 29.7%[25] - Net cash provided by operating activities increased to $1,407,000 for Q1 2025, compared to $168,000 in Q1 2024, showing a substantial improvement[25] - The company incurred stock-based compensation of $1,872,000 in Q1 2025, up from $1,296,000 in Q1 2024, reflecting a rise of approximately 44.4%[23] Strategic Focus - The company is focused on operational streamlining and higher-return initiatives to enhance profitability[4]
Wag! (PET) - 2025 Q1 - Quarterly Results
